Town are looking for ways of improving the Portman Road matchday experience ahead of next season and want to hear fans’ ideas.

What do you want to see before the game? What sights or sounds as the players take to the field? And what about at half-time entertainment?

What’s impressed you elsewhere at other clubs in the UK or abroad, or even at other sports? Add anything you’d like to see introduced at Portman Road below and we’ll pass them on. And yes, they know about winning more matches.

Warkalone added 19:26 - Apr 26
Move the away fans to near the SBR stand. This is ESSENTIAL. The club needs to persuade the Police that all hell isn't going to break loose just because they have to walk another 100 yards further,(most of the people in the Cobbold stand are old anyway! & Town fans are really pretty good) Keep the away fans in for 10 mins after game to stop any potential problems. I have been to away matches and been kept in a few minutes after the game, so why don't we do this. This is the one thing GUARANTEED to improve atmosphere, and it won't cost a penny.

Tannoy in SBR lower cannot be heard. Do not switch the lights on until the ref has blown the half time/final whistle. Put new locks on the ladies loos, they are useless (and some more soap dispensers). Put old Town goals on the screens before the game and 2 big screens in the stadium showing great goals at half time would be good. No music after a goal.

BIGDAZ added 20:45 - Apr 26
First thing i would do is move the away supporters nearer the Sir Bobby Robson stand. Really pump the music up with about 20 mins to kick off to get the crowd going and singing so the players can here it in the changing rooms. The half time entertainment has been rubbish for years so i would scrap it. Cheaper tickets is a must with more deals where season ticket holders can buy extra tickets cheap. I went to selhurst park and they had a family day and laid on entertainment outside the ground for the kids. We just need to get that buzz around portman road again.
